I'm unable to get my levels to line up. The first pic, you can see the open price is around 21295 on 06/02/25.

In the second pic, the open price highlighted in green on the TPO chart is 21506 for 06/02/25.

What am I doing wrong? I'm using replay on the first pic and simply scrolling back to that date on the TPO chart, but the levels should still line up.

Although most likely the reason why you would be seeing different values on different charts is that you are using a Continuous Futures Contract chart with back-adjusting on one chart and not on the other. Refer to the following:
